The ingredients needed to make Chicken Curry:
  1. Take chicken
  2. Take Big leaf
  3. Make ready Bay leaf
  4. Prepare Cloves
  5. Get Salt and red chilli powder
  6. Take garam masala
  7. Get ginger garlic paste
  8. Prepare Turmeric
  9. Prepare chopped onion
  10. Take chopped of tomato
  11. Prepare Daniya & kotimir paste
  12. Take chicken masala

Steps to make Chicken Curry:
  1. Take a pan heat it add oil then big leaf, cinnamon, pepper, cloves & flower stir it well if it cooked & start smelling add onion & fry it then add ginger garlic paste stir it well, Now add your washed chicken & stir it and add turmeric, garam masala, chilli powder & mix it well then make a flame to medium and wait for 2 or 3 mins and then stir it well & add tomato and salt
  2. If the tomatoes are cooked well and get soft then add daniya and kotimir paste & stir it and add required amount of water to the measure of chicken and stir it well and cover the pan and make a flame to low and cook it for 10 to 15 mins until it turns into a gravy. Now if it's ready then add add chicken masala & just cook for 2mins & serve it…😊
